The state Public Utility Commission said Wednesday it will hold two public hearings on Aug. 3 in the Greensburg area to hear testimony on FirstEnergy Inc.'s proposed $8.5 billion acquisition of Greensburg-based Allegheny Energy Inc.
The hearings will be at 1 p.m. Aug. 3 at the Greensburg Garden & Civic Center auditorium, 951 Old Salem Road, Greensburg, and at 6 p.m. at the University of Pittsburgh at Greensburg campus' Campana Chapel and Lecture Center off Mt. Pleasant Road in Hempfield.See the full content of this document
